Fórum

Como faço para sair de uma operação depois de uma sequencia de candles?

Estou com dificuldade para contar os candles para sair de uma operação. Alguém consegue me dar uma mãozinha

O preço passa pelos stops várias vezes e não aciona

Olá, estou desenvolvendo um EA mas tem acontecido algo bem estranho. O preço passa por cima da linha de stop e breakeven e não aciona a ordem de encerramento. Só depois de passar algumas vezes por cima da linha. Alguém tem uma ideia do que seja

Take profit na segunda vela que deu lucro

Olá, estou tentando colocar meu takeprofit na segunda vela que deu lucro, não precisam ser seguidas as velas. Alguém pode me ajudar? void CompraAMercado( double num_lots_, double ask, double TK_, double SL_) {trade.Buy(num_lots_, _Symbol , NormalizeDouble (ask, _Digits ), NormalizeDouble (ask-SL_*

Não para de emitir ordem

Pessoal, estou tentando o seguinte. Tem um candle que dá o sinal de entrada, a ordem é executada no próximo, os dois candles na tendência. As vezes após o candle de entrada, no terceiro candle, ocorre uma reversão de tendência. Criei uma função que fecha a ordem anterior e entra como uma ordem

Ordens para reversão

Pessoal, estou tentando o seguinte. Tem um candle que dá o sinal de entrada, a ordem é executada no próximo, os dois candles na tendência. As vezes após o candle de entrada, no terceiro candle, ocorre uma reversão de tendência. Criei uma função que fecha a ordem anterior e entra como uma ordem

Ainda Breakeven

Alguém sabe me dizer como faço para acionar o breakeven depois de duas velas com lucro, podendo ser uma seguida da outra ou não. Estou tentando desta forma mas não está dando muito certo void Breakeven() { if ( PositionSelect ( _Symbol )&& PositionGetInteger ( POSITION_TYPE )== POSITION_TYPE_BUY )

Breakeven

Pessoal, estou tentando adicionar um breakeven que é acionado quando o segundo candle com lucro é encerrado mas só recebo esta mensagem: 2022.01.27 16:07:54.542 2015.01.02 11:00:00 failed modify #2 sell 0.01 EURUSD sl: 0.00000, tp: 0.00000 -> sl: 0.00000, tp: 0.00000 [Invalid stops] Alguém pode dar

Breakeven

Pessoal, estou tentando colocar em funcionamento o Breakeven que é acionado quando o segundo candle, com lucro é encerrado. Mas só recebo esta mensagem: 2022.01.27 16:07:54.542 2015.01.02 11:00:00 failed modify #2 sell 0.01 EURUSD sl: 0.00000, tp: 0.00000 -> sl: 0.00000, tp: 0.00000 [Invalid stops]